Sporting items have come a long way from their humble beginnings, evolving in design and materials to optimize performance and durability. Whether it's a tennis racket or a golf club, the materials utilized in their building play an important function in determining how well they perform on the court or course. In this article, we delve into the fascinating world of sporting items supplies, exploring how innovation has reshaped the way athletes wield their equipment.  
  
Tennis Rackets:  
Tennis, a sport known for its agility and precision, requires rackets that provide both energy and control. Traditional wooden rackets have given way to modern, high-tech materials like carbon fiber composites. These materials are prized for their lightweight nature, glorious power-to-weight ratio, and resistance to deformation.  
Carbon fiber rackets have revolutionized the game, allowing players to generate more energy while maintaining control over their shots. The mix of carbon fiber with different supplies like graphite and Kevlar has led to the creation of rackets that aren't only robust and lightweight but in addition incredibly responsive.  
  
Golf Clubs:  
Golf, alternatively, depends on precision and accuracy. Golf clubs, particularly drivers and irons, have seen significant advancements in materials and design. Traditional wooden clubheads have been replaced with modern supplies corresponding to titanium and composite alloys.  
Titanium, known for its high strength and low density, is a popular choice for driver clubheads. This material allows for bigger clubhead sizes and enhanced forgiveness, making it easier for golfers to achieve better distance and accuracy off the tee. Additionally, using composite materials, equivalent to carbon fiber, in club shafts has allowed for improved swing speed and control.  
  
Basketball:  
Basketball is a fast-paced sport the place players want equipment that can withstand intense use. Basketball materials have evolved from leather to synthetic materials like rubber and composite leather. These materials offer superior durability and grip while ensuring constant bounce and feel.  
  
Soccer Balls:  
Soccer balls have undergone a similar transformation, transitioning from leather to artificial materials. Modern soccer balls are typically made from supplies like polyurethane or thermoplastic polyurethane (TPU). These supplies provide wonderful durability, water resistance, and consistent flight traits, permitting for a more predictable and controlled game.  
  
Running Shoes:  
In the world of running, footwear is paramount. The supplies utilized in running shoes can significantly impact performance and comfort. Traditional running shoes typically featured leather uppers and rubber soles. Right this moment, most running shoes utilize lightweight and breathable artificial materials for uppers, akin to mesh and synthetic leather. The midsoles are sometimes made from supplies like EVA (ethylene-vinyl acetate) or polyurethane, providing cushioning and support. Advanced cushioning technologies, like Nike's Air and Adidas's Enhance, use specialized foam supplies to reinforce comfort and energy return.  
  
Tennis Balls:  
Tennis balls have additionally seen material innovations. Traditionally made from rubber and covered with felt, tennis balls now feature advanced core designs and synthetic materials. These supplies provide constant bounce and durability, guaranteeing that tennis players can depend on a predictable and responsive ball during matches.  
  
Ski Equipment:  
Winter sports like skiing have benefited from the development of advanced materials. Ski construction has shifted from wood to fiberglass, aluminum, and even carbon fiber. These materials provide improved energy, flexibility, and responsiveness, enhancing a skier's ability to navigate challenging terrains.  
  
Biking:  
Cycling is another sport where supplies play a critical role. Modern bicycles are constructed from lightweight supplies like carbon fiber and aluminum. These supplies supply high strength-to-weight ratios, allowing cyclists to ride faster and with higher control.
